Output d83b50645968bb83f28c565434c17c416ec8ef724ef98c621f9a3618c8dc8835:5

value
4008808
script pubkey
OP_0 OP_PUSHBYTES_20 e82ecd7d06eaf948247202f97b924f146176a314
address
bc1qaqhv6lgxatu5sfrjqtuhhyj0z3shdgc54glmws
transaction
d83b50645968bb83f28c565434c17c416ec8ef724ef98c621f9a3618c8dc8835
confirmations
74516
spent
true